Output 7068e60d211d6a37a33534575e7ffece1a2d3de3442a4eb0454d7051cc949f39:0

value
75291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6079e820d6cc0cd793944ce20ccdb87a90b1106a OP_EQUAL
address
3AV8qBvAArXbari8EL6GtR6PL4JD3GUfWy
transaction
7068e60d211d6a37a33534575e7ffece1a2d3de3442a4eb0454d7051cc949f39
confirmations
238979
spent
true